Porch Carpentry in Seattle, WA
Porch carpentry services encompass the construction, repair, and enhancement of porch structures to improve both functionality and curb appeal. This includes building new porches, replacing or repairing existing ones, and upgrading features such as railings, steps, posts, and flooring. Property owners often seek these services to create inviting outdoor spaces, enhance safety, or restore the appearance of their home's entryway. Understanding the scope of the project, the types of materials used, and the overall design preferences are common considerations before requesting porch carpentry work.
Homeowners typically want to know about the durability of different materials, the compatibility with existing structures, and any design options that match the home's style. Clear communication about project size, budget, and desired features helps ensure the finished porch meets expectations. It is also helpful to consider how the porch will be used, whether for relaxing, entertaining, or increasing property value, to select the most suitable design and features.

Common Porch Carpentry Jobs
Porch Enclosures - custom screens and glass enclosures to extend outdoor living space.
Porch Repairs - fixing damaged or worn porch components to ensure safety and stability.
Porch Rebuilds - replacing or reconstructing existing porches for improved durability and appearance.
Column and Railing Installation - adding decorative or functional supports to enhance porch safety and style.
Deck and Porch Painting - applying protective finishes to preserve wood surfaces and improve curb appeal.
Custom Porch Designs - creating tailored layouts that complement home architecture and homeowner preferences.
Porch Carpentry Questions
What types of porch carpentry projects are common? Typical projects include porch repairs, railing installations, new porch construction, and decorative trim work.
What materials are used in porch carpentry? Common materials include pressure-treated wood, cedar, composite decking, and decorative moldings.
How does porch carpentry enhance property value? Well-maintained porches improve curb appeal and can add functional outdoor space to a property.
What should homeowners consider before starting porch carpentry? It's important to assess the existing structure, desired design, and durability requirements for the project.
